How To Fix MSAM_CL000 - Error occured while releasing the order


MSAM_CL000 - Overview

  • Message type: E = Error

  • Message class: MSAM_CL - Message Class for MSAM

  • Message number: 000

  • Message text: Error occured while releasing the order

    The SAP error message MSAM_CL000 typically indicates that there was an issue when trying to release a production order or a similar type of order in the SAP system. This error can arise from various causes, and understanding the specific context of the error is crucial for troubleshooting. Here are some common causes, potential solutions, and related information:
    Common Causes:
    
    
    Missing or Incorrect Data: Required fields in the order may be missing or contain incorrect data. This could include missing material numbers, quantities, or other essential information.
    
    
    Status Issues: The order may be in a status that does not allow it to be released. For example, if the order is already completed or canceled, it cannot be released again.
    
    
    Authorization Issues: The user attempting to release the order may not have the necessary authorizations to perform this action.
